1 What Job Learned Through Suffering

2  Blameless & Upright  Feared God  Wife – 10 children  Livestock

3 JOB SUFFERED  Livestock all killed  All 10 children killed  Boils on his flesh “ In all this Job did not sin with his lips.” Job 2:10 Friends came to comfort

4 I. Job Learned about his Friends  Fair weather friends  Miserable Comforters - Job 16:2  Sin cause of suffering 4:7 8:6  Suffering to keep from sin

5 Suffering Shows Something about Friends  Some are fair weather friends  “...there is a friend that sticks closer than a brother.” Prov. 18:24  “A friend loves at all times” Prov. 17:17

6 2. Job Learned About His Wife  Not very encouraging  “Curse God and die” Job 2:9  Not a help  But a hindrance

7 We learn about Our Companion  A good wife is a rare jewel  Prov. 31:10, Prov. 31:12  Help meet for man – Gen.2:18

8 3. Job Learned About Himself  Testing is essential  Tested by suffering  “though He [God] slay me, yet will I trust Him.” Job. 13:15

9 We learn about ourselves  We do not know if faith is strong until tested “When I am weak, then am I strong” 2 Cor. 12:10

10 We learn about ourselves  We do not know if faith is strong until tested “Indeed we count them blessed who endure. You have heard of the perseverance of Job and seen the end intended by the Lord—that the Lord is very compassionate and merciful.” Jas. 5:11

11 4. Job Learned About God  Learned more in this short time than a lifetime  Job was very serious about his relationship with God

12 We Learn About God We Learn About God  One side of God we learn only through suffering  We learn that:  He Cares  He loves us  Being right with God is most important

13 “ No temptation has overtaken you except such as is common to man; but God is faithful, who will not allow you to be tempted beyond what you are able, but with the temptation will also make the way of escape, that you may be able to bear it.” 1Cor. 10:13
